



Welcome to the Afghanistan Security Institute (ASI)
ASI is an independent think tank dedicated to providing insightful, evidence-based analysis on Afghanistan’s security and its critical role in regional and global stability. Our mission is to promote a secure, peaceful Afghanistan, free from terrorism and extremism, as a cornerstone of international security. Through local engagement, international cooperation, and fact-driven insights, we aim to shape policy decisions and foster a safer world.
We lead bold, actionable initiatives that tackle the most pressing security challenges, including radicalism, refugee crises, and regional instability. By driving innovative projects and fostering strategic partnerships, ASI ensures that Afghanistan’s security is not only addressed but also positioned at the forefront of global peacebuilding efforts, creating a safer world for future generations.
